Tim Worley (1985-88) was one of UGA's first great out-of-state running backs. The native of Lumberton, N.C., drew comparisons to Herschel Walker with his combination of speed and size. Worley rushed for 1,216 yards on 191 carries in 1988 after redshirting the 1987 season for academic reasons. He skipped his final season to enter the NFL draft. Rich Addicks / AJC file
